The Rise of Alphabet's Tensor Processing Units in the AI Market
Alphabet's Tensor Processing Units (TPUs) are capturing the attention of investors and industry analysts alike, who envision them as a burgeoning multi-billion-dollar revenue stream for the tech giant. Initially developed for in-house artificial intelligence applications, these specialized chips are now poised to transition from a foundational internal resource to a substantial external market offering. This strategic pivot is driven by the TPUs' proven efficacy in accelerating AI workloads and their potential to offer a cost-effective alternative in a market currently dominated by graphics processing units (GPUs).
The growing confidence in TPUs is reflected in the significant rally of Alphabet's stock, particularly within the last quarter, signaling investor recognition of this untapped potential. Wall Street analysts are increasingly bullish, forecasting that by making TPUs available to third parties, Alphabet could access a market opportunity approaching one trillion dollars. This not only promises to bolster Alphabet's financial performance but also to enhance its Google Cloud services by providing clients with highly optimized and efficient AI infrastructure, further cementing its competitive edge.
Challenging Nvidia's Dominance and Market Diversification
The emergence of Alphabet's TPUs presents a compelling challenge to the long-standing market dominance of Nvidia in the AI chip sector. Analysts highlight that TPUs offer a viable alternative for companies seeking to diversify their hardware suppliers and mitigate risks associated with reliance on a single vendor. This is particularly relevant given current supply constraints and the high demand for advanced AI processing capabilities. Projections from financial institutions suggest a robust adoption rate for TPUs, with estimates indicating millions of units could be sold in the coming years, contributing significantly to Alphabet's overall revenue.
Alphabet has already initiated strategic steps to commercialize its TPUs, including multi-billion-dollar supply agreements with key players in the AI industry and reported discussions with other tech titans. While some market observers suggest that companies may be turning to TPUs as a temporary solution to Nvidia's supply limitations, the underlying efficiency and cost-effectiveness of these chips are undeniable. Furthermore, the increasing trend of major tech companies developing custom AI silicon underscores a broader industry shift towards specialized hardware, intensifying competition and fostering innovation in the AI chip ecosystem.
